Join our growing team supporting customer missions as a Junior Systems Integrator in Herndon, Virginia.We are looking for experienced System Integrator to join our technology-based program supporting a key government customer. This program will deliver engineering services for network infrastructure as well as sophisticated enterprise computing infrastructure including end-point devices, data center hosted servers, multi-Cloud services as well as virtualized applications, and storage systems. Enterprise Computing Engineering services include modern application technology including containerized solutions with orchestrated workflow that function both on customer premise, and via remote Cloud services. Network infrastructure engineering services are comprised of core infrastructure, voice and video engineering, field engineering, application management and development for networks, network analytics, firewalls, network access controls and bandwidth service delivery.
